How Cancer Drugs Work: The Cell Cycle, Log-Kill and Why We Combine Them
Cancer is one idea gone wrong: a cell that divides when it should not, and refuses to die. Almost every classical cancer drug is a counter-move to that single idea — it attacks cells while they divide. But that strategy carries three hard truths with it: each dose kills a fraction, not a number; one drug is rarely enough; and the poison cannot tell a tumour cell from your gut lining. Understand those three and the whole rhythm of chemotherapy — the cycles, the combinations, the toxicities — stops looking like a mystery and starts looking like arithmetic.
Chemotherapy Toxicity and Dosing: The Narrow Line Between Help and Harm
Cytotoxic chemotherapy has no address of its own. It kills what divides fast — and cancer is not the only thing dividing fast inside you. The same drug that shrinks a tumour also strips the bone marrow, the gut lining, the hair, the gonads. So the whole craft of oncology is a balancing act on a very narrow ledge: enough to hurt the cancer, not so much that you kill the patient. Learn the predictable toxicities, the nadir, and the maths behind mg/m² and AUC, and chemo stops being frightening and becomes something you can anticipate.
